How old is your chick? Do you have any poop pictures? Corid is only given in the water, although you can give 0.1 ml per pound of weight of the undiluted Corid once a day as a boost. Otherwise dosage is 2 tsp or 10 ml per gallon of water (or 1/2 tsp per quart) for 5-7 days. That is the maximum treatment dosage. After 5-7 days you can reduce the dosage to 1/4 dosage for another 5 days if needed.
